P much that. Pocketing someone basically means trying to get someone to townread you as a wolf. "Having someone in your pocket", etc.
And I don't really know what more you want other than I feel that was way too early to read into that Xel post (and I don't know what InD has to do with this), and you trying to poke at Subaru for it was some low-hanging fruit as - no offense Subaru - going after the weakest player, as a wolf, is a decent strategy if you're looking to build town cred. |
